Output 66c90b9fc0ac703a0005028fab04e8c33e15361a8f909dc94df44809c15fff32:0

value
1072680
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6348fc14510c52a69488bc7805989fbb83e38ed8 OP_EQUAL
address
3AjzFbjvCMztdwBi7otiQpG8s3uba7hQ8R
transaction
66c90b9fc0ac703a0005028fab04e8c33e15361a8f909dc94df44809c15fff32
spent
true